How they compare

India currently reports 18.78 billion against 15.88 billion in Republic of Korea, a difference of 2.90 billion.

That makes India's figure about 1.2 times Republic of Korea's.

The two have swapped places 11 times across 81 shared years of data; in 1945 it was Republic of Korea ahead.

India ranks 13th and Republic of Korea ranks 15th of 196 countries.

Across the 9 decades both report, India averaged higher in 5 and Republic of Korea in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ade India Republic of Korea Difference Ahead
1940s 0 0 0 β€”
1950s 0 0 0 β€”
1960s 0 0 0 β€”
1970s 249.39 million 15.47 million 233.91 million India
1980s 290.09 million 31.37 million 258.71 million India
1990s 89.40 million 50.78 million 38.63 million India
2000s 520.19 million 407.00 million 113.19 million India
2010s 3.24 billion 3.36 billion 115.13 million Republic of Korea
2020s 15.64 billion 13.21 billion 2.43 billion India

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
